This project proposes a hybrid face recognition method combining CNNs with HOG, SIFT, Gabor, and Canny feature extraction techniques, enhancing accuracy under variations like lighting and pose using optimized activation and training functions.

1. A hybrid approach for face recognition

This project models an AI-based enterprise callbot using NLP and machine learning algorithms. SVM achieved the best performance, significantly improving cost efficiency, response time, and service quality compared to human agents.

2. Modeling of an artificial intelligenc

This project enhances road defect detection by optimizing YOLOv5s, reducing parameters, improving feature fusion with an SPPF module, and integrating attention mechanisms—achieving faster, accurate detection with better efficiency, despite limited generalization

3. Efficient Road Defect Detection Network

This project uses a U-Net-based CNN with a ResNet-34 encoder for automated pavement crack segmentation, reducing feature engineering needs and improving accuracy. A one-cycle learning rate schedule accelerates training convergence effectively.

4. Automated Pavement Crack Segmentation
